Swine Surveillance for Public Health Planning

  • Published: 2013January 7, 2020
  • Subject(s):
    influenza, pH1N1, zoonotic
  • Author(s): Lee Wisener Jan M. Sargeant
  • Project No: 134

This Evidence Review summarizes and highlights the current state of knowledge and the key issues of swine influenza virus surveillance to inform public health policies, programs and practices.

Primary Influenza Prevention and Control Measures in Pig Farms

  • Published: 2013January 7, 2020
  • Subject(s):
    influenza, pH1N1, zoonotic
  • Author(s): Nicolas Bertrand Jean-Pierre Vaillancourt Carl A. Gagnon Josée Harel Chantale Provost
  • Project No: 153

A summary of the known facts and key issues concerning the prevention of primary influenza and the control measures in pig farms, for the purpose of shedding some light on policies, programs, and practices.

About Us

At the National Collaborating Centre for Infectious Diseases, we specialize in forging connections between those who generate and those who use infectious disease public health knowledge. Working across disciplines, sectors and jurisdictions, NCCID is uniquely situated to facilitate the creation and operation of networks and partnerships. From policy to practice, we’re able to build bridges between those with infectious disease questions, those with answers, and those in a position to act on the evidence.

Our host organization is the University of Manitoba.
